摘要
在软件开发过程中,技术盲点常被开发人员忽视,然而这些忽略问题可能埋下严重的开发隐患,进而对项目进度与系统稳定性造成深远的工作影响。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。专家提醒,开发团队应加强对非功能性需求的关注,如可维护性、安全性与性能边界,这些常被视为次要却极易演变为关键瓶颈。此外,缺乏跨团队沟通与文档沉淀也被列为高发盲区。提升对隐形风险的认知,建立定期审查机制,有助于提前发现潜在问题,减少后期修复成本。在快速迭代的开发环境中,关注这些易被忽略的细节,是保障长期项目成功的关键。
关键词
技术盲点,开发隐患,忽略问题,工作影响,专家提醒
在软件开发的日常实践中,技术人员往往聚焦于功能实现、算法优化与系统架构设计,而那些潜藏于代码深处的“技术盲点”却常常被有意无意地忽略。这些忽略问题并非源于能力不足,而是因为在紧迫的交付压力下,非功能性需求如可维护性、安全性与性能边界被视为次要考量。然而,正是这些看似微不足道的疏忽,可能悄然埋下开发隐患。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。许多开发者坦言,在追求快速迭代的过程中,文档沉淀和跨团队沟通常被搁置,形成了信息孤岛。这种短期效率优先的思维模式,虽能带来即时成果,却也为系统的长期稳定运行埋下了伏笔。
当技术盲点未被及时察觉,其对项目进度的侵蚀往往是渐进而隐蔽的。初期可能仅表现为个别模块响应缓慢或测试覆盖率不足,但随着系统复杂度上升,这些忽略问题逐渐累积成难以逆转的技术债。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。原本预计两周完成的功能扩展,可能因依赖关系混乱或缺乏清晰接口定义而拖延数月。更严重的是,一旦核心组件暴露出安全隐患或性能瓶颈,整个团队不得不暂停新功能开发,转入紧急修复状态。这种被动应对不仅打乱了产品节奏,也极大消耗了团队士气。专家提醒,忽视这些隐形风险,终将在后期付出更高的时间与资源代价。
在一个典型的中型电商平台重构项目中,开发团队为加快上线节奏,决定沿用旧有的用户认证模块,认为其“运行稳定无需改动”。然而,该模块缺乏完善的日志记录与权限隔离机制,属于典型的技术盲点。起初,这一决策确实节省了开发时间,但上线三个月后,系统遭遇一次异常登录激增事件,由于无法追溯来源且权限校验存在漏洞,导致部分用户数据被越权访问。事故调查发现,正是这个被忽略的模块成为了攻击入口。修复过程耗时六周,涉及多个服务的联动调整,并被迫推迟了原定的新功能发布计划。此案例印证了专家提醒:那些常被视为次要的非功能性需求,极易在关键时刻演变为关键瓶颈,带来不可估量的工作影响。
要有效应对技术盲点带来的开发隐患,必须从开发流程的源头建立预防机制。首先,团队应在项目启动阶段明确非功能性需求的重要性,将可维护性、安全性与性能边界纳入初始设计评审范畴,而非留待后期补救。其次,强化跨团队沟通机制,避免因信息不对称导致的重复劳动或接口冲突。同时,推动文档的持续沉淀与版本同步,确保知识不随人员流动而流失。定期组织代码审查与架构评估,有助于识别潜在的代码债务与架构缺陷。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。因此,专家提醒,唯有将隐形风险显性化,才能从根本上减少忽略问题对整体工作的深远影响。
技术盲点的治理并非一劳永逸,而是一个需要持续监控与动态优化的过程。随着系统迭代和业务扩展,原有的安全策略、性能阈值和依赖关系可能逐渐失效,形成新的隐患。因此,建立自动化监控体系至关重要——通过静态代码分析工具检测代码质量趋势,利用APM工具追踪系统性能波动,设置告警机制以及时发现异常行为。同时,应定期开展“技术健康度评估”,邀请内外部专家进行独立审查,打破团队内部的认知局限。这种机制不仅能提前暴露潜在的开发隐患,还能促进知识共享与最佳实践传播。在快速迭代的开发环境中,唯有保持对技术盲点的敏感度,才能真正实现可持续的高质量交付。
开发隐患,是指在软件开发过程中那些未被及时察觉但可能在未来引发严重后果的技术缺陷或管理疏漏。它们往往隐藏于代码逻辑深处、架构设计边缘或团队协作缝隙之中,表现为缺乏日志记录、权限控制薄弱、接口定义模糊、文档缺失等问题。这些隐患并非突发性故障,而是长期积累的“慢性病”。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。正因如此,识别开发隐患不能依赖事后补救,而应贯穿于需求分析、设计评审、编码实现与测试交付的每一个环节。尤其需要警惕的是,那些被标记为“后续优化”或“暂时可用”的模块,常常成为系统崩溃的导火索。唯有通过系统性的审查机制和对非功能性需求的持续关注,才能将这些潜伏的风险从暗处拉入视野。
当开发隐患未能被及时发现,其对软件质量的侵蚀往往是结构性且深远的。最初可能仅表现为响应延迟、偶发报错或部署失败,但随着系统迭代加深,这些问题会像病毒般扩散,影响整体稳定性与用户体验。一个缺乏安全校验的认证模块,可能让整个平台暴露于越权访问风险之下;一段未经充分测试的核心逻辑,可能在高并发场景中引发雪崩效应。更严重的是,隐患的存在会显著降低系统的可维护性与扩展性,使得新功能开发举步维艰。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。这不仅意味着资源浪费,更可能导致客户信任流失与品牌声誉受损。因此,隐患问题绝非技术细节的瑕疵,而是决定软件生命周期长短的关键因素。
要有效避免开发过程中的隐患,必须从文化、流程与工具三个层面协同推进。首先,团队需建立“质量优先”的共识,摒弃“先上线再修复”的短视思维,将可维护性、安全性与性能边界纳入初始设计评审范畴。其次,在开发流程中强化代码审查、架构评审与自动化测试机制,确保每一行代码都经得起推敲。同时,推动文档的持续沉淀与版本同步,防止知识随人员流动而断裂。跨团队沟通也至关重要,信息孤岛往往是隐患滋生的温床。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。因此,专家提醒,唯有将隐形风险显性化,才能从根本上减少忽略问题对整体工作的深远影响。预防胜于治疗,这是应对开发隐患最有力的策略。
一旦开发隐患演变为实际故障,迅速而有序的应急处理成为止损的关键。此时,团队应立即启动应急预案,明确责任人与响应流程,避免陷入混乱。首要任务是隔离受影响模块,防止问题蔓延至核心系统;随后通过日志追踪、监控数据与调用链分析,快速定位根本原因。在修复过程中,应避免仓促修改,坚持回归测试与灰度发布原则,确保修复不会引入新的风险。与此同时,保持与相关方的透明沟通,及时通报进展,有助于稳定内外部信心。值得注意的是,应急处理不仅是技术挑战,更是组织协作能力的考验。据近期一项技术会议披露,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。因此,每一次应急响应都应被视为一次学习机会,事后必须进行复盘,提炼经验教训,完善防控机制。
要实现对开发隐患的长效治理,必须构建一套可持续运行的预警系统。该系统应融合自动化工具与人工评审机制,形成多层次的监测网络。通过静态代码分析工具实时检测代码质量趋势,利用APM工具追踪系统性能波动,并设置告警阈值以捕捉异常行为。同时,定期开展“技术健康度评估”,邀请内外部专家进行独立审查,打破团队内部的认知局限。此外,建立知识库与案例档案,将过往的隐患事件结构化归档,为未来决策提供参考。这种机制不仅能提前暴露潜在的开发隐患,还能促进最佳实践的沉淀与传播。在快速迭代的开发环境中,唯有保持对技术盲点的敏感度,才能真正实现可持续的高质量交付。专家提醒,忽视这些隐形风险,终将在后期付出更高的时间与资源代价。
在软件开发过程中,技术盲点与开发隐患往往因被忽略而演变为严重影响项目进度与系统质量的瓶颈。专家提醒,超过60%的项目延期与维护成本上升,源于早期未识别的架构缺陷与代码债务。这些问题多发于非功能性需求的疏忽,如可维护性、安全性与性能边界,以及缺乏跨团队沟通和文档沉淀。案例表明,忽视认证模块的日志记录与权限隔离等细节,可能引发严重安全事件,造成数周修复周期与发布推迟。因此,建立从预防、监控到应急响应的全流程机制至关重要。通过代码审查、架构评估、自动化监控与技术健康度检查,可有效提升对隐形风险的识别与应对能力。在快速迭代的环境中,唯有持续关注这些常被忽视的问题,才能保障软件系统的长期稳定与高质量交付。